WIRE FROM THE AGENT-GENERAL.

Wellinotok, This day. The Premier has received the following cable message from the Agent-General : ' " British repulsed at every point except Arundel. "British total' loss, so far, inoluding disease, 7700. " Dntcb element in Bechuaualand northeast of Cape Colony, and north of Natal, join the Boers. " European Press hostile and jubilant. "Roberts and Kitchener proceed to the Cape. " Further reinforcements of 50,000 men."
